Herm Edwards

Herman Edwards Jr. is an American football coach and former professional player who was most recently the head coach at Arizona State. He played cornerback in the National Football League (NFL) for ten seasons, primarily with the Philadelphia Eagles. Edwards was also a head coach in the NFL from 2001 to 2008 with the New York Jets and Kansas City Chiefs. Following the conclusion of his NFL coaching career, Edwards was a football analyst at ESPN from 2009 to 2017. He returned to coaching in 2018 when he was named the head coach of Arizona State. Former NFL and college football head coach Herm Edwards is rejoining ESPN November 4, 2022, as a football analyst. Edwards, whose coaching career spans more than 30 years. In his new role, Edwards will contribute to ESPN's NFL and college football coverage across a variety of shows and platforms.
